Description Jona Tallieu 2007-05-15 05:00:51 PDT
When using the latest nightly, the Google Maps JS does not work anymore.
The JS Console says: Error: HIERARCHY_REQUEST_ERR: DOM Exception 3
(line 658).

It works fine in current Safari and Firefox.
Comment 1 David Kilzer (:ddkilzer) 2007-05-15 07:51:25 PDT
Confirmed with a local debug build of WebKit r21473 with Safari 2.0.4 (419.3) on Mac OS X 10.4.9 (8P135).  Does not occur with shipping Safari.
Comment 2 David Kilzer (:ddkilzer) 2007-05-15 07:54:40 PDT
Note that there should be red "pins" on the test page which don't appear when this error occurs.
